response = requests.delete('https://api.example.com/items/1') 1. 2. 3. 这行代码将会删除ID为1的item。以上就是如何在Python中使用REST API的基本操作。在下一部分,我们将探讨如何在Python中创建自己的REST API。 REST和Python:构建API 构建REST API不仅仅是编写代码,更需要良好的设计和规划。以下是一些...
github_url='https://api.github.com/user/repos'password_manager=urllib2.HTTPPasswordMgrWithDefaultRealm()password_manager.add_password(None,github_url,'user','***')auth=urllib2.HTTPBasicAuthHandler(password_manager)# create an authentication handler opener=urllib2.build_opener(auth)# create an op...
本节显示执行PUT Rest API调用的Python脚本的示例。此功能将LDAP属性映射添加到现有Active Directory配置。 注意:注意:在继续操作之前,必须通过GET函数收集更新对象所需的信息。 URL1 Active Directory领域:/api/fdm/v6/object/realms/ URL2 LDAP属性映射: /api/fdm/v6/object/ldapattributempaps import request...
prefix="/api/v1")auth=HTTPBasicAuth()USER_DATA={"admin":"SuperSecretPwd"}#route to verify the password@auth.verify_passworddefverify(username,password):ifnot(usernameandpassword):returnFalsereturnUSER_DATA.get(username)==passwordclassPrivateResource(Resource):@auth...
http://apiv1.example.com 使用自定义请求标头进行版本控制 Accept-version:v1 Accept-version:v2 使用Accept header 进行版本控制 Accept:application / vnd.example.v1 + json Accept:application / vnd.example + json; version = 1.0 1. 2. 3. ...
GET /cars HTTP/1.1 Host: api.example.com 此 HTTP 请求由四部分组成:GET 是 HTTP 方法类型。/cars 是 API 接口。HTTP/1.1 是 HTTP 版本。主机:api.example.com 是 API 主机。GET 这四个部分是您向/cars 发送GET请求所需的全部内容。现在来看看响应。此 API 使用 JSON 作为数据交换格式:HTTP/1.1...
对Python 调用 OpenDaylight 的 REST API 方法有初步了解。 二、实验任务 本实验需要用另一种方法完成上一个实验相同的功能,即通过 Python 程序调用OpenDaylight 的北向接口下发关于硬超时的流表,实现拓扑内主机在一定时间内的网络通断。实验拓扑如下: 三、实验步骤 ...
上文《Power BI REST API实战教程:PowerQuery为例》讲解了PBI API调用的经典方法,而本文将利用简短的Python脚本,更快捷,高效,简易地实现这个效果。在经典方法中,主要问题在于获取Access Token(访问令牌)较为麻烦,需要设置的地方较多,本文将会利用Python,免去自建Azure应用的麻烦,直接借用微软为我们提供的访问令牌来实现...
Python 1.x REST Python client = AzureOpenAI( api_key=os.getenv("AZURE_OPENAI_API_KEY"), api_version="2024-08-01-preview", azure_endpoint = os.getenv("AZURE_OPENAI_ENDPOINT") ) my_assistant = client.beta.assistants.retrieve("asst_abc123") print(my_assistant) ...
Python 复制 import requests import json 为要进行拼写检查的文本、订阅密钥和必应拼写检查终结点创建变量。 你可以使用以下代码中的全局终结点,或者使用资源的 Azure 门户中显示的自定义子域终结点。 Python 复制 api_key = "<ENTER-KEY-HERE>" example_text = "Hollo, wrld" # the text to be spell-ch...